I went in depth about how OP Early Toons were, and started trying to piece together how my version of Bendy would be based off of that. If he were indeed to exist in the real world, he’d be less an intentionally evil, demonic entity and more of a Lovecraftian reality warper. I felt Lovecraft was a good reference to use for how out there my guy: a powerful being from somewhere unattainable, with terrifying power and no immediately clear motivation. But then I remembered something that I think perfectly sums him up even better...
SALLY CRUIKSHANK
Especially her short Face Like A Frog
Not only did I love watching it growing up, but it’s the perfect case of mindf***ery I need for further studying. Just pure, surrealist, nonsensical animation that makes it hard to follow, but GOD you just can’t take your eyes away.
Also with a bit of Marcell Jankovics style, especially from his film Fehérlofia. PLEASE check it out!
This is my Bendy. Unpredictable, unfathomable, and uncontrollable. Yet mesmerizing and wondrous to watch. However, Bendy rarely, if ever, goes out of his way to seriously hurt people. Most of the time, it’s just him screwing around and making people question what they really experienced. Like: random shape-shifting, turning things into other things, and pulling off incredible illusions that scare the hell out of people. But all of it in good fun even if it’s mostly for him. Nonetheless, there is a passive, unsettling feeling his mere presence inspires to those who aren’t accustomed to it. It’s disturbing yet they can’t seem to pull away. The longer they’re near him, the more intense the feelings get— sometimes overcoming them even. Despite all this, Bendy seems rather blasé about his effects on people. Whether he doesn’t know, or just doesn’t care, it’s unknown.
One can only assume what would happen if he really let loose though. His true form would be nothing short of a paradox. It would be everything yet nothing, due to how literally incomprehensible it is. Think of those Deep Dream pics and how baffling those are. Sure, some pieces of it you’d be able to recognize, but, it’s immediately lost among everything else. While the nature of his birth and the Ink Machine is one reason this might be—
